Common Lennox Air Duct Cleaning Problems We Solve in Worcester

  • Flex-duct couplings separating at plaster transitions. Lennox flex-duct connections in Worcester’s retrofitted triple-deckers frequently pull apart where they meet original lath-and-plaster walls. The building settles, the plaster cracks, and suddenly you’ve got a gap dumping debris into a wall cavity you can’t reach without demolition. We spot these with pre-cleaning video inspection and seal them properly.
  • Blower compartment buildup from extended heating seasons. Worcester’s inland elevation stretches heating season weeks past Boston’s, and that Lennox blower runs harder, longer. Dust packs onto the squirrel cage, motors overheat, airflow drops. We pull and clean the entire blower assembly — not just vacuum around it.
  • Evaporator coils trapping moisture near asbestos-wrapped pipes. In cramped retrofit systems — especially near WPI and Clark University — Lennox coils sit so close to original asbestos-wrapped steam pipes that clearance is measured in inches. Moisture condenses, mold spores colonize, and the coil becomes a distribution point for contaminants. We video-inspect first, then clean with controlled techniques that don’t disturb adjacent insulation.
  • Undersized return drops creating negative pressure. Lennox return air ducts shoehorned into closet spaces draw attic dust and insulation fibers through every gap. We’ve found returns in Worcester triple-deckers pulling so hard they whistle — and the homeowner’s been breathing fiberglass for years.
  • Fire-caulked floor penetrations missing or crumbling. Worcester zoning requires fire-caulking at duct penetrations in pre-1950 buildings. Most retrofits skipped it. We identify these gaps during cleaning and seal them — it’s not optional, and it’s not something a basic duct cleaning includes.

Lennox Service in Worcester: What Local Conditions Mean for Your Equipment

Here’s a Worcester-specific reality that shapes every Lennox duct cleaning we perform: Worcester’s zoning laws require that retrofitted ductwork in pre-1950 buildings be fire-caulked at floor penetrations — a rule often ignored during the original HVAC retrofit, creating pathways for smoke and fire spread between units in triple-deckers and two-families. When we clean a Lennox system in a 1920s Grafton Hill building or a 1940s Piedmont duplex, we’re not just removing debris. We’re identifying where that fire-stopping was never installed, where it’s crumbled away, and where a previous contractor cut corners to save twenty minutes. For Lennox owners specifically, this matters because the brand’s flex-duct connections and snap-lock fittings are particularly vulnerable to vibration and thermal cycling in these old buildings — gaps that should be sealed for fire safety also leak conditioned air, waste money, and draw contaminants back into the system. We seal what we find. If I wouldn’t let it sit in my own house, I’m not leaving it in yours.

Lennox Service Pricing in Worcester

Lennox air duct cleaning in Worcester ranges from $280 for a straightforward single-system cleaning to $550 for complex multi-unit triple-decker jobs with video inspection, fire-caulking, and sanitizing. Here’s how pricing breaks down:

  • Single-system Lennox duct cleaning: $280–$380
  • Multi-unit building (per additional system): $180–$260
  • Video inspection with before/after documentation: $85–$120
  • Duct sealing and fire-caulking repair: $150–$280
  • Air quality sanitizing (Abatement Technologies/Guardsman): $95–$175

What drives cost? Accessibility. A Lennox system in a 1990s ranch with full basement? Straightforward. Lennox in West Boylston is similar. The same unit in a Piedmont triple-decker with ducts routed through a closet and clamped to steam pipes? That’s where our eleven years of Worcester-specific experience earns its keep.
